摘要: 0、oracle数据库脚本 1 create table userinfo 2 (id number(4), 3 name varchar2(50), 4 password varchar2(20 5 telephone varchar2(15), 6 isadmin varchar2(5)); 7 阅读全文
posted @ 2016-05-26 23:20 红酒人生 阅读(976) 评论(0) 推荐(0) 编辑
摘要: AOP(Aspect Oriented Programming),即面向切面编程。 1、OOP回顾 在介绍AOP之前先来回顾一下大家都比较熟悉的OOP(Object Oriented Programming)。OOP主要是为了实现编程的重用性、灵活性和扩展性。它的几个特征分别是继承、封装、多态和抽象 阅读全文
posted @ 2016-05-26 23:08 红酒人生 阅读(2537) 评论(0) 推荐(3) 编辑
摘要: Spring是为了解决企业应用开发的复杂性而创建的一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架。在这句话中重点有两个,一个是IoC,另一个是AOP。今天我们讲第一个IoC。 一. IoC理论的背景 我们都知道,在采用面向对象方法设计的软件系统中,它的底层实现都是由N个对象组成的,所有 阅读全文
posted @ 2016-05-26 22:37 红酒人生 阅读(1342) 评论(2) 推荐(2) 编辑
摘要: Java EE优缺点 我们都知道在2003年Spring兴起之前,企业普遍使用J2EE技术来开发企业级应用,为什么用J2EE呢?主要原因有以下几个: 虽然J2EE有着上述优点,但利用J2EE开发有一个致命的缺陷,即研发困难,而且J2EE开发非常容易出问题,比如数据库连接泄露。而Spring的出现则解 阅读全文
posted @ 2016-05-26 22:16 红酒人生 阅读(815) 评论(0) 推荐(2) 编辑